What does transit mean in banking?

deposit in transit
A deposit in transit is money that has been received by a company and recorded in the company’s accounting system. The deposit has already been sent to the bank, but it has yet to be processed and posted to the bank account.

What is payment in transit?

Payments in transit refer to all payments you have ordered the bank to carry out but for which you have yet to receive a confirmation in the form of a bank statement. As soon as you receive the statement from the bank, the payment in transit line is no longer seen in the overview.

What is lodgement in bank reconciliation?

Therefore a lodgement will appear on the bank statement as a credit entry, as it increases the liability of the bank to the account holder. In the books of the account holder, a lodgement will be a debit entry in the bank account on the general ledger.

Which is the correct spelling lodgement or lodgment?

In U.S. English, the term is spelled “lodgment,” whereas in British English, it is spelled “lodgement.” In Ireland, people use what is called a lodgment slip to deposit money into a bank account, according to Wikipedia.
